For anyone who is confused please understand that natural gas is NOT gasoline, and liquid natural gas is natural gas deep frozen and condensed for export. “In December 2021, the U.S. exported more liquefied natural gas (LNG) than any country in the world—an incredible achievement for a country whose exports were negligible just a few years ago. Through the first 10 months of 2021, total U.S. LNG exports surpassed $25 billion in value, and IHS Markit is now projecting that America will surpass Qatar and Australia in 2022 to claim global leadership on an annual basis.”
“Finally, as we and many others have documented time and again, natural gas is the primary driver behind America’s world-leading emissions reductions since 2005. Similar reductions can be achieved if this model is deployed globally, not only by replacing coal use in developed and emerging economies, but also because life-cycle emissions of U.S. LNG is often superior to that of gas pipelined from Russia. Add it all up, it’s clear that U.S. natural gas production delivers a trifecta of benefits: economic advantages to U.S. families and businesses, energy security dividends to allies and partners around the world, and substantial greenhouse gas emissions reduction opportunities.”
